
Brussels – Israeli forces have boarded and taken control of multiple ships in the Global Sumud Flotilla, which was trying to break Israel’s blockade of Gaza and had attracted worldwide attention as one of the largest naval aid missions to the Palestinian enclave.
The Global Sumud Flotilla, which includes more than 40 civilian boats and about 500 parliamentarians, lawyers, and activists transporting medicine and food to Gaza, was intercepted by Israeli forces late on Wednesday, with activists on board detained and taken to Israel.
How did Israeli forces intercept the Global Sumud flotilla?
According to the flotilla organisers, Israel intercepted a group of boats carrying humanitarian aid. They reported that Israeli naval forces intercepted the vessels approximately 70 nautical miles from Gaza’s coast, disrupting communications and jamming signals as the flotilla approached the blockaded area.
According to the flotilla’s tracking system, Israeli forces halted 14 boats carrying foreign activists and aid destined for Gaza on Thursday. It has shared several videos on Telegram featuring messages from people on the boats, some holding passports and claiming they were abducted and taken to Israel against their will, while emphasising that their mission was a peaceful humanitarian effort.
A video from the Israeli foreign ministry, verified by Reuters, showed Swedish climate campaigner Greta Thunberg, the most prominent passenger of the flotilla, sitting on a deck surrounded by soldiers.
What was Israel’s response?
“Several vessels of the Hamas-Sumud flotilla have been safely stopped and their passengers are being transferred to an Israeli port,”
The Israeli foreign ministry stated on X.
“Greta and her friends are safe and healthy.”
Israel’s Ministry of Foreign Affairs posted a video of a woman in military uniform speaking on the phone, identifying herself as a representative of the Israeli navy.
